The Distance Between Us is a heartfelt contemporary romance that explores love after loss, healing from grief, and finding the courage to embrace who we truly are.

A year after losing his fiancé in a tragic plane crash, Cameron is still struggling to move forward. Gregg, meanwhile, appears to have the perfect life on the surface, but beneath the wealth and expectations of his family lies a man who has never truly been free to be himself. Despite coming from completely different worlds, Cameron and Gregg form an unexpected connection that slowly grows into something meaningful.

I really enjoyed their relationship. Their romance develops through chance encounters, long-distance conversations, and making the most of the time they have together. Cameron and Gregg are almost opposites in many ways, yet they complement each other surprisingly well. I loved watching them not only learn about each other's lives and experiences, but also discover new things about themselves through the other's perspective.

While the romance is at the heart of the story, there are plenty of heavier themes woven throughout. Cameron's grief is a constant presence, and the author does a good job of showing both the pain of loss and the gradual process of healing. Gregg's journey is equally compelling, as he struggles with family expectations, his fear of coming out, and the difficult choice between living the life others want for him and pursuing the life he truly desires.

While I loved the emotional core of the story, I did find myself wishing for a bit more exploration of some of the major events that occur later in the book. Certain storylines felt like they were resolved rather quickly, and I would have liked to spend more time with the characters as they processed the emotional fallout.

That said, these issues never lessened my investment in Cameron and Gregg's journey. I was completely drawn into their story from beginning to end, rooting for them through every setback and triumph. Their relationship felt genuine, their growth felt earned, and I loved watching them find both love and a better understanding of themselves along the way.

Overall, The Distance Between Us is a heartfelt, emotional debut that tackles grief, healing, self-acceptance, and second chances with warmth and sincerity. It may not be perfect, but it was exactly the kind of story that kept me turning pages and thinking about the characters long after I finished.
